Event Overview

6 days, 35 Venues and 100 bands

Left Coast Live is a week-long music experience showcasing the talent of 100 local, regional and national bands in 35 Downtown San Jose venues including cafes, museums, bars and restaurants.  The event starts with a future of music discussion series, two preview concerts, and one outdoor cinema, and culminates in a giant walkable live music festival in downtown San Jose.

This 6 day live music event was born from a group of local musicians, venue owners and arts supporters who were determined to grow live music in the South Bay.  These visionaries knew that, by working collectively, they could ignite the local music scene and ultimately make San Jose and Silicon Valley known around the region and the country as a center for thriving live music.

Monday through Thursday events for Left Coast Live are free and will be open to the public.  Admission for the Friday and Saturday evening concerts are $15 for an advanced purchase ticket and $20 at the door each night. Student tickets are available for $20 (must bring ID to check-in kiosk).
This week-long Music Festival includes:

*     “Sound of Things to Come” Discussion Series,  a forum to explore different aspects of music in today’s society from digital music and industry trends to intimate artist discussions Monday – Thursday from 6:00 pm – 8:00 p.m. at various downtown locations.
*     Free preview concerts – Concerts highlighting some of the best regional acts – yet to be determined.*
*     Film discussion – There is no denying that music and film intersect, join us as we explore the connection. We’ll be partnering with Cinequest Film Festival to bring you a film that is sure to inspire the musician in us all.
*     Friday and Saturday Night Live Music Festival kicks off with a mix of outdoor stages in the South of First Area of downtown San Jose.  Headliners start at 5:30 pm and Left Coast Live fills 30 venues with music  acts in a variety of styles, including indie pop, rock, jazz, urban soul, jazz and latin. 2009 performers included Lyrics Born, Booker T.,  Miggs, The Mumlers, La Colectiva, Max Cabello Jr., Martin Luther, Gina Villalobos, Careless Hearts, The Marcus Shelby Trio and Good Hustle.
